Sunday 12 September 2010

LICC Art Competition 2010

LICC Art Competition 2010

London International Creative Competition™ (LICC) is a vehicle for facilitating contact between uniquely talented artists and an international audience.

The 2010 London International Creative Awards
Was held September 12, 2010 • Soho Theatre, London.